Body

Origins and Family

Mohammad Tarshahani was born on +1952-01-01T00:00:00Z[2]. Arabic was his native language[6].

Education

Mohammad Tarshahani's education included a stint at Peoples' Friendship University of Russia[14].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include politician[3] and diplomat[4]. Among Mohammad Tarshahani's employers was Ministry of Telecommunications and Digital Economy of the State of Palestine[13]. Positions held include ambassador of Palestine to Albania[7], ambassador of Palestine to Uzbekistan[8], ambassador of Palestine to Tajikistan[9], ambassador of Palestine to Turkmenistan[10], ambassador of Palestine to Kyrgyzstan[11], and ambassador of Palestine to Afghanistan[12].

Recognition

Awards received include Astana Medal[15], a medallion[26], in Kazakhstan[27], founded in 1998[28]; Medal "10 Years of Independence of the Republic of Kazakhstan"[16], a jubilee medal[29], in Kazakhstan[30], founded in 2001[31]; and Dostyk Order of grade II[17], a grade of an order[32], in Kazakhstan[33], founded in 1995[34].
